Instead of spending his time at school, eight-year-old Josh spends most of his days in hospital.

He has battled cancer twice already and visits the hospital every couple of weeks for chemotherapy — unless his family car doesn't break down.

A Current Affair wanted to make sure Josh's birthday was one he would never forget, so we handed his mum Alison the keys to a brand new car, along with a boot full of presents.

Alison came out to tell Josh's story for only one reason.

The family aren't after financial donations, they want to encourage people to donate blood.

She said Josh has had to wait in hospital for blood products to come in because they aren't readily available.
